When considering installing replacement windows on your Mandarin, FL home, you may have questions about which material to choose. You have numerous options, including Fibrex®, wood, fiberglass, and vinyl.

Wood is, of course, a natural material, while vinyl is a PVC plastic composed of vinyl chloride. Fiberglass is a reinforced plastic made of glass fibers and resin, while Fibrex® is a composite that combines wood grains and plastic polymers. Each of these is a good choice for replacement materials. The information below will help you select one.


The Pros And Cons Of Vinyl Replacement
Windows In The Mandarin, Florida Area

Vinyl is among the most popular types of replacement windows on the market, in part because of its affordability. It is often the least expensive material, but the low price often comes with drawbacks.

For instance, its color may fade, and the frames may warp under the intense Mandarin, FL sun. You may also have only a limited number of options in terms of colors and styles. Moreover, vinyl does not offer the sound-dampening capabilities of some other materials. This can be a drawback if you sleep or work from home during the day.


Why Choose Wood Replacement Windows
In The Jacksonville, Florida Region?

Wood is a natural and renewable material. It degrades over time, and its components return to the earth, nourishing the soil and furthering the cycle of life. Wood grain is very attractive, and it is prized for its beauty.

It is a very dense material and contains countless layers – as depicted in the numerous rings of the trunk. As such, it offers more insulation capability than vinyl does. This keeps heat indoors during winter and outdoors during summer. Because of this, you may spend less on heating and cooling your home with windows of this type.

Wood takes stain, paint, and other coatings well, which means you can change its color and texture almost at will. When you tire of the current paint or stain, you can refinish it. This makes it ideal for homeowners who like frequent changes.

On the other hand, wood takes the most upkeep of any replacement window material. It must be painted and stained regularly to protect the material from absorbing moisture. Stain fades and paint peels, leaving the wood susceptible to water damage.

Water damage can include warping, rotting, staining, and swelling. Other materials do not suffer these consequences.


Advantages Of Fiberglass Replacement Windows
On Your Mandarin, FL-Area Home

Fiberglass window frames are exceptionally durable. They do not warp, crack, or fade as wood windows can. They typically last 20 years or longer without significant problems arising.

Fiberglass resists heat transfer, so windows of this type are more energy-efficient than some other choices – such as vinyl or aluminum – although less so than wood. They have very low maintenance requirements because they never need painting, staining, or scraping. Simply clean them occasionally and keep the hardware clean and oiled.

Fiberglass is considered eco-friendly because of its low thermal conductivity and because many makers use recycled materials to manufacture it. It is available in many colors, textures, and styles, so you are sure to find a style you like and that fits your home’s architectural style.


The Pros And Cons Of Fibrex® Windows
On A Mandarin, FL Home

Fibrex® windows are a mostly environmentally friendly option because they are often made from recycled materials. They are robust and durable. They usually last for decades, and – because they are made of wood and plastic polymers – they do not require the upkeep that wood does. They can be painted, but this is not required.

They do not absorb moisture and maintain their shape, whatever the weather. They come in different styles and colors and only need occasional cleaning to look their best for decades.

On the other hand, Fibrex® windows are the most expensive type. They are an exclusive product of Andersen, which means they are not as widely available as other types, and installers are limited. They are also limited in their available colors, so you might not find windows that fit your home’s style.
